Ben Williams Recruitment is seeking a Children's Home Deputy Manager in Colchester, England. The role focuses on leading a dedicated team to provide exemplary residential care for children with complex needs.
Candidates should have:
- Experience in children's residential care
- A Level 4 Diploma for Residential Childcare
- A full UK Driving License
The position offers a competitive salary, benefits tailored to individual needs, and career development opportunities including further qualifications.
